Graduate-Level Research in Industrial Projects for Students will offer
graduate students in mathematics and related disciplines the opportunity
to work on industry-sponsored research problems. Students from the U.S.
and Germany will work on cross-cultural teams on three research problems
designed by the industrial sponsor. The projects will be of serious
interest to the sponsor and will offer a stimulating challenge to
students; most will involve both analytic and computational work. At the
end of the program, the teams will present the results of their work and
prepare a final report. English is the only language required for
participation.
